Had a server running Server 2003 and Exchange 2003. Server was running out of space so I purchased a new server. Installed Server 2003, Exchange 2003, and moved all the mailboxes over to the new server. Now, when ever I try to access some one elses mailbox (which I was able to do before) I get the following error.
"Unable to display the folder. Microsoft Office Outlook could not access the specified folder location." I also recieve a pop up error that says "unable to expand the folder. The operation failed. An object could not be found".
I've looked at several different K articles but none of them have helped. Any suggestions?
Thanks in advance
 
First point of call I would say is look in AD at the security of the mailbox your are trying to access. You will probably find that only SELF has access to the mailbox.

As a test add yourself in the mailbox and ensure you have full rights to it.
